Four water molecules are formed when five amino acids are joined together to make a polypeptide chain through a process called peptide bond formation. Each peptide bond formed releases one water molecule.
When a peptide of 10 amino acid will form there will be the evolution of 9 molecules of water,which amounts to 162(9*18),where 18 is the MW of water. Now a peptide is having 10 amino acids which means including all the molecules weight should be 110*10=1100 but we have to take out the weight of 9 water molecules for the final calculation .Therefore 1100-162 will be 938. So the answer is 938

200 molecules of water would be required to break down a protein with 200 peptide bonds. Each peptide bond is broken by a water molecule in a hydrolysis reaction, splitting the bond and releasing an amino acid.

A non-peptide hormone is a type of hormone that is not made up of amino acids arranged in a peptide chain. Instead, non-peptide hormones are typically small organic molecules or derivatives that act as signaling molecules in the body. Examples include steroid hormones like cortisol and sex hormones like estrogen and testosterone.
